Background: The ‘Why Now’
Today’s digital landscape is characterized by fluid search behaviors. Instead of typing queries, many users now rely on discovery-based browsing, where content finds them based on their interests. Google Discover, with its personalized content feed, is central to this trend, becoming an essential traffic driver for publishers.
Recently, Google rolled out updates designed to amplify content visibility on Discover. According to a report from Search Engine Land, these changes aim to increase engagement by allowing users to follow their favorite publishers and surface more content from social media platforms like X, Instagram, and YouTube Shorts. The implication is clear: as Discover evolves, so must the strategies of publishers and content creators to stay relevant and maximize reach.
The Core Strategy: Understanding and Leveraging Google’s New Discover Features
The key to unlocking Google Discover’s potential lies in understanding its new features and tailoring content strategies accordingly.
Optimize Content for Discover’s Updated Algorithms: Discover’s algorithms favor content that is fresh, engaging, and aligned with user interests. Publishers should prioritize optimizing their content formats and topics to meet these criteria. This includes using high-quality images, leveraging engaging storytelling techniques, and focusing on trending topics that resonate with audiences.
Enhance User Engagement Through Personalized Content: With the new features, Discover can deliver more personalized content experiences. Publishers should leverage this by creating interactive and personalized content that caters to specific audience segments. By understanding user preferences and feedback, content can be tailored to enhance reader engagement and retention.
Utilize Analytics for Strategic Refinement: Google Discover provides valuable data and insights that can guide content strategy refinements. By analyzing which types of content get featured and receive high engagement, publishers can adjust their approaches, ensuring they consistently meet user expectations and algorithmic preferences.
Experiment with Multimedia and Storytelling: The new Discover features favor diverse content types, including multimedia elements. Publishers should experiment with incorporating videos, interactive graphics, and other multimedia formats to capture attention and boost engagement.
Actionable Insights & Pro-Tips
To maximize the potential of Google Discover, publishers can implement several expert strategies:
Craft Compelling Headlines and Snippets: The value of a well-crafted headline cannot be overstated. It should be intriguing, concise, and keyword-rich to attract both users and algorithmic attention. The same applies to snippets, which should offer a compelling tease of the content within.
Optimize Timing and Frequency: Understanding Discover’s content surfacing patterns can significantly enhance visibility. Publishing content at times when user engagement is highest can increase the chances of content being featured.
Leverage User Intent Feedback: Discover’s user feedback mechanisms provide insights into what content resonates. Publishers should pay close attention to this data, adjusting their content accordingly to align with demonstrated user preferences.
Cross-Platform Promotion: Bolstering Google Discover signals through cross-platform content promotion can enhance a publisher’s visibility. Utilizing social media to drive traffic to articles can provide additional momentum, signaling to Discover that content is popular and worth featuring.
